About Huiming Yin
Huiming Yin is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Materials Chemistry, Process Chemistry and Technology and Automotive Engineering, having authored 47 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(22 papers), Nanoporous metals and alloys (16 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(11 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(7 papers), TiO2 Photocatalysis and Solar Cells (5 papers), Fuel Cells and Related Materials (5 papers),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(5 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(856 citations), Electrochemistry (104 citations), Materials Chemistry (659 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(667 citations) and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(199 citations). Huiming Yin has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Yi Ding, Yongli Shen, Xiaohong Xu, Fangliang Chen, Liang Wang, Jun Luo, Chao Li, Jia He, Shuai Yin and Xizheng Liu. Their work appears in journals such as Electrochimica Acta, The Journal of Physical Chemistry C, Nano Research, Chemical Engineering Journal and ChemElectroChem.
